Town: Trearddur Bay is a village situated on Holy Island, part of the Isle of Anglesey in North Wales. Trearddur Bay is known for its exceptional beach, with fine white sands and clear blue waters, you'd be forgiven for mistaking it for somewhere more tropical on a summer's day! The village itself is home to cafés, shops, pubs and restaurants, some with excellent sea views. Nearby is the town of Holyhead with its ferry links to Ireland, as well as the Breakwater Country Park.
